Where are the basis charter schools in the US?

There are also two BASIS charters in Texas and one in Washington, D.C. Economists Michael and Olga Block started the first BASIS charter school in Tucson in 1998. They thought that low expectations for American students were leading schools to dumb down the curriculum. As surprising as it is to some people, many kids like a challenge.

When to file a claim against a school district in California?

The California Tort Claims Act sets forth very specific guidelines for filing claims. Generally, a person who wishes to file a claim against a school district must file a claim within 6 months for claims which are for: Personal injury, Wrongful death, or; Damage to personal property. The time limit may be extended in certain limited circumstances.
